Why Invest in a Professional Drill?
Before diving into specifics, it is important to comprehend the benefits of owning a professional-grade drill:
- Durability: Professional drills are developed to last, even under frequent usage.
- Adaptability: These drills can handle a range of jobs, from drilling holes to driving screws.
- Power: Professional-grade drills normally have more torque and speed settings, offering better performance.
- Precision: They enable more control over the drilling procedure, causing cleaner and more precise outcomes.
Secret Features to Look For
When browsing for a cheap professional drill, specific features need to be top of mind:
| Feature | Description | Significance |
|---|---|---|
| Power Source | Corded or cordless choices | Identifies portability |
| Chuck Size | Typical sizes are 1/4 inch, 3/8 inch, and 1/2 inch | Impacts the bits you can use |
| Voltage (for Cordless) | Higher voltage usually suggests more power | Secret for efficiency |
| Speed Settings | Variable speed settings for different tasks | Increases flexibility |
| Weight | Lighter models permit easier handling | Impacts fatigue over time |
| Battery Life | For cordless drills, longer battery life is preferable | Guarantees constant usage |
| Warranty | Try to find designs with solid guarantees | Essential for long-lasting financial investment |

Accessories to Consider
When buying a drill, it's practical to have a variety of accessories on hand. Here's a list of must-have accessories that complement your drill:
| Accessory | Description |
|---|---|
| Drill Bit Set | A variety of drill bits for various materials |
| Screwdriver Bit Set | For driving screws quickly and effectively |
| Charger | A spare charger can be beneficial, specifically for cordless designs |
| Carrying Case | Assists organize and safeguard your equipment |
| Depth Stop | Helpful for drilling to specific depths |
| Hole Saw Kit | For bigger cutting jobs |
| Magnetic Bit Holder | Reduces dropping screws; speeds up floor covering jobs |

Tips for Purchasing
- Read Reviews: Customer feedback can supply insights that requirements may not cover.
- Examine Physically (if possible): If buying in-store, check the feel and weight of the drill.
- Search for Packages: Some retailers bundle drills with accessories at an affordable price.
- Examine Return Policies: Ensure you can return or exchange your drill in case it doesn't fulfill your needs.
FAQ
Q1: Can I find quality drills under ₤ 100?
A1: Yes, many respectable brands offer reputable drills within that price range, particularly during sales or marketing occasions.
Q2: What's the difference between corded and cordless drills?
A2: Corded drills tend to provide constant power and are typically more appropriate for sturdy jobs, while cordless drills offer convenience and portability.
Q3: How do I keep my drill?
A3: Regularly tidy it, inspect battery health, keep bits sharp, and describe the manufacturer's guidelines for lubrication and detailed upkeep.
Q4: Are the less expensive drills less effective?
A4: While cheaper drills might have lower torque, many affordable options still load enough power for common household jobs.
Q5: Is it necessary to have numerous drill bits and accessories?
A5: Yes, having a variety of bits and accessories optimizes your drill's versatility, enabling you to deal with a more comprehensive series of tasks.
